Voltage
Thermostats run on either line voltage or low voltage. The easiest way to tell which type
you need is by looking at the wire. If it is a very thin wire (like a doorbell or a speaker
wire), you will need a low voltage thermostat. If it is a heavy wire, you will need a line
voltage thermostat.
Changeover Type
Thermostats either have automatic changeover or manual changeover. Thermostats
with auto changeover switch from heat to cool automatically depending on the indoor
temperature, while thermostats with manual changeover will remain on either heat or
cool until you change it.
Sensors
An indoor sensor communicates with your thermostat so that you can control the
temperature without actually mounting a thermostat in that room. Instead the small
sensor is mounted in the room and the temperature is controlled from a thermostat
mounted in the boiler room, hallway, or even hidden in a closet.
An outdoor sensor allows you to have the outdoor temperature show right on your
thermostat, so you can check the temperature without even stepping outside or turning
on the news.
